The Common Challenges of Leadership in Renewable Energy Industries
As a Senior Project Manager working within an international team responsible for delivering Turnkey Energy and Distribution Management Systems, you're undoubtedly familiar with the complexities of managing multifaceted projects. Your role, which spans across Europe, Africa, and the Middle East, requires a deft handling of multiple facets — from basic operational logistics to intricate stakeholder engagement and strategic resource deployment.
Challenges Senior Level Faces in Power Projects:
1. Complex Workflow Management:
- Scenario: Navigating the intricate matrix of working internationally can create a labyrinth of workflows, each with its own requirements and dependencies. Imagine a situation where you are overseeing the installation of a new Distribution Management System in a country with an underdeveloped grid infrastructure.
- Pain Point: Coordinating between onshore and offshore teams, ensuring all parties are aligned, and handling disruptions due to unexpected regulatory changes or civic issues.
- Solution Need: A centralized project management tool that provides real-time updates and automates task dependencies can help senior managers maintain clarity over ongoing tasks, deadlines, and personnel responsibilities.
2. Keeping Teams Aligned:
- Scenario: Your team in Tanzania, while strong, deals with challenges like geographical distance from key decision-makers or main offices. Miscommunication or misaligned objectives can lead to costly delays or quality issues.
- Pain Point: Ensuring the alignment between disparate teams (technical, financial, administrative) that may be working across different time zones or cultural contexts.
- Solution Need: Implementing a robust communication platform that supports collaboration, version control, and seamless information flow, which keeps everyone on the same page.
3. Ensuring Projects Run Smoothly Without Micromanagement:
- Scenario: While micro-managing can sometimes seem like the quickest route to solutions, it can demotivate skilled professionals and stifle innovation.
- Pain Point: Balancing oversight with autonomy, allowing teams the freedom to innovate while ensuring they're aligned with project objectives.
- Solution Need: Introducing agile project management methodologies can empower teams, ensuring flexibility, while regular check-ins and KPIs keep everyone accountable.
4. Stakeholder Management:
- Scenario: You have to manage relationships with customers, local administrations, subcontractors, and consortium partners in potentially varying regulatory environments.
- Pain Point: Diverse stakeholder priorities can sometimes lead to project deadlocks or conflicts. Aligning all interested parties while maintaining customer satisfaction requires a nuanced approach.
- Solution Need: A well-developed stakeholder management strategy, supported by a CRM system, can streamline communication efforts, ensuring clarity and setting realistic expectations from the outset.
5. Risk and Opportunity Management:
- Scenario: While overseeing an onshore project, unpredicted risks such as political instability or supply chain disruptions could arise. Meanwhile, keeping an eye out for additional business opportunities is a significant focus.
- Pain Point: Rapid changes in project conditions could affect timelines and costs, while identifying scalable opportunities can often be overlooked.
- Solution Need: Implementing a dynamic risk management framework that enables early risk detection and mitigation strategies, alongside business intelligence tools, can unearth new potentials that align with ongoing and future projects.

Terms
- Kanban View
- A type of space view that visualizes workflow processes in columns representing different stages of work. Tasks are displayed as cards that can be moved as they progress.

- Calendar View
- A visual space layout of tasks using a traditional calendar format, allowing users to see and schedule tasks by day, week, or month.

- Gantt Chart View
- Displays time-dependent cards on a timeline using a bar chart format, ideal for planning and managing long-term tasks.

- Card Blocker
- An obstacle preventing task progress, categorized as local, global, or on-demand blockers, making issues explicit and categorized.
